3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is correlation?

Back

A relationship between two variables

Answer explanation

Correlation refers to a relationship between two variables, indicating how they may change together. The correct choice highlights this fundamental concept, distinguishing it from random or independent relationships.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What type of correlation might exist between ice cream sales and beach ball sales if more people buy ice cream and more beach balls are sold?

Back

Positive correlation

Answer explanation

Extrella observes that as ice cream sales increase, beach ball sales also rise. This indicates a positive correlation, where both variables move in the same direction.
